Evidence for the decays B 0 → D ¯ (*)0 ϕ and updated measurements of the branching fractions of the B s 0 → D ¯ (*)0 ϕ decays

Abstract:
Evidence for the decays B0→D¯0ϕ and B0→D¯*0ϕ is reported with a significance of 3.6 σ and 4.3 σ, respectively. The analysis employs pp collision data at centre-of-mass energies s = 7, 8 and 13 TeV collected by the LHCb detector and cor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 9 fb−1. The branching fractions are measured to beBB0→D¯0ϕ=7.7±2.1±0.7±0.7×10−7, BB0→D¯∗0ϕ=2.2±0.5±0.2±0.2×10−6. In these results, the first uncertainty is statistical, the second systematic, and the third is related to the branching fraction of the B0→D¯0K+K− decay, used for normalisation. By combining the branching fractions of the decays B0 → D¯∗0ϕ and B0 → D¯∗0ω, the ω-ϕ mixing angle δ is constrained to be tan2δ = (3.6 ± 0.7 ± 0.4) × 10−3, where the first uncertainty is statistical and the second systematic. An updated measurement of the branching fractions of the Bs0 → D¯∗0ϕ decays, which can be used to determine the CKM angle γ, leads toBBs0→D¯0ϕ=2.30±0.10±0.11±0.20×10−5, BBs0→D¯∗0ϕ=3.17±0.16±0.17±0.27×10−5.
